Missouri state Rep. Michael O’Donnell, R-Oakville, has accepted the role of commissioner of securities under new Secretary of State Denny Hoskins.
"I look forward to continuing my service to Missouri in this new capacity and am committed to ensuring a smooth transition for my successor in the 95th District," O’Donnell said.
The 95th District, which covers the southern part of St. Louis County, will have a special election for O’Donnell's successor. Roughly 61% of voters gave O’Donnell the nod for the seat in November.
